UNC, Fedora Agree On Contract Extension Through 2022 Posted Dec 5, 2015 The University of North Carolina and head football coach Larry Fedora have agreed in principle to a new seven-year contract, director of athletics Bubba Cunningham announced Saturday. The agreement runs through the end of the 2022 season and increases his compensation package. Terms of the contract will require formal approval by the UNC Board of Trustees. (GoHeels.com)
